Graduate of Olivier de Serres and the Birmingham Institute of Art and Design in 2002, Piergil Fourquié worked for prestigious creative studios such as Arik Lévy or Philippe Starck. A tireless worker, he is also developing his own projects by collaborating with Galerie Gosserez in Paris. In 2013, he became the leader in an accessible and forward-looking design by founding the French Federation of Design which aims to highlight young creative talents and local crafts. Author of an elegant design with feminine curves, Piergil Fourquié created his studio in 2015 and now collaborates with many publishing houses and craftsmen to design delicate and sensitive objects.
The designer Piergil Fourquié imagined a range of contemporary cement tiles. We find minimalist and geometric patterns in several colors. He chose to work on a square format 15×15 cm and on a hexagonal format 15×17.35 cm. Indeed, these small sizes recall the old houses, which gives a retro side to your interior decoration. We love the pose of these patterns in living rooms such as the bathroom, the kitchen or the entrance. It will also be possible to combine plain cement tiles to break the rhythm of the patterns or to add a border.
